- [ ] Step 7: Archive cold storage buckets (Glacierline tier). Confirm both ceremony witnesses are present, verify bucket manifests match the Oxbow ledger, then seal the archive key shares. Plugin authors may observe but not handle shares. Once sealed, the archive index itself is encrypted and can only be reopened with the passphrase below.

vault phrase of badup-hahig = tamael-aldael-kelmir-istael-fenok-istwyn-tamius-jorath-oliion

Handover: Exportron retry queue

Hi Mira — handing over the failed-export retries. Exports that hit a timeout land in the retry queue and get three attempts with backoff; after that they're parked and need a manual requeue from the admin panel. Watch for customers reporting duplicates — that usually means a double requeue. The current retry settings are as follows.

settings of bajog-fawig:
oliael:
  log_level: warn
  metrics_host: metrics.oliael.zemvarsys.internal
  pin: 0267
  pool_size: 32

The scheduled collection for the Fennick Ridge relay station did not occur on Tuesday. Pallet 14 (bearings, hydraulic seals, two valve actuators) remains staged at bay 6, shrink-wrapped and labelled. Cairnway Logistics has confirmed a replacement slot for Thursday, 10:00. Shift lead: keep the pallet in the secure cage until then, re-check the seal count against the packing sheet, and have the transfer form ready. When the replacement driver arrives, pass on the hand-over instruction written below.

handover note for yagef-bagep: the drudor pelius courier leaves the kasdor zorvan norir ledger at gate 8016 under passcode 755406

## Ownership

The Tilewren prefetcher predicts map-tile demand along planned routes and warms the edge cache ahead of requests. Future maintainers should know that the prediction model, the cache eviction policy, and the per-region quota logic are all considered one ownership unit; changing any of them in isolation has historically caused regressions. Before altering prefetch heuristics or quota math, read the design notes in this repo and obtain sign-off from the component owner named below.

account owner for bawip-tahag: Raleth Quenok